Why Lunar Ice Matters Now

The potential discovery of ice on the moon is more than a scientific curiosity. It opens up numerous opportunities for future space missions, including the possibility of sustainable human presence on the lunar surface. Here’s why this mission is crucial:

  • Resource Utilization: Lunar ice could serve as a source of water and oxygen, essential for sustaining life during long-term missions.
  • Energy Production: Ice can be converted into hydrogen fuel, paving the way for advanced space travel.
  • Scientific Insight: Studying lunar ice can provide valuable information about the moon’s history and the solar system.
  • National Security: Control over lunar resources may become a strategic asset in geopolitical relations.

China's Technological Advancements in Space

China's growing capabilities in space technology are evident in its ambitious plans. Over the past decade, the country has made significant strides, launching multiple lunar probes and even landing its rover on the moon. This upcoming mission is part of China’s strategic vision to establish a sustainable presence in space. Understanding the technological advancements that have led to this moment is crucial:

Recent Achievements

  • Successful landing of Chang'e-4 on the far side of the moon in 2019.
  • Ongoing development of the Tiangong space station, set to be fully operational soon.
  • Continued investments in rocket technology and satellite systems.
